PSPS Govt PG College organises awareness Lecture on Preparation of Competitive Examinations

JAMMU, DECEMBER 21: Career Counseling and Placement Cell, in Collaboration with Institutional innovation Club and Alumni Association of Padma Shri Padma Sachdev Govt PG College for Women organised an Awareness Talk on preparation of Competitive Exams in the Department of Commerce here today.

The programme started with the formal welcome of the Resource Person, Prof. Mamta Gupta, Dean Commerce and a galaxy of intellectuals and student aspirants.

Rhythm Bhatia, Alumnus of the College apprised students about various career opportunities in the field of Commerce. She also stressed upon gaining skills to become an entrepreneur.

Neha Thapa, another alumnus deliberated upon getting admission in higher Education through exams like CAT,  MAT, GREF etc.

Mohammad Arshad Nomani, Resource Person of the day highlighted the roadmap for the preparation of Civil Services Examinations and motivated the students to aid their studies with time management to achieve the goal.

CA, Anuj Mahajan , the other Resource Person explained   the stepping stones to become  a Chartered Accountant and Entrepreneur.

On behalf of the Principal of the College , Dr. Irvinder Kour appreciated the efforts of the organizing Committee comprising Prof. Rajni Kumari, Convenor Career Counselling and Placement Cell ; Prof. Anupama Sharma, Convenor Institution Innovation Club and other members Prof. Malti, Prof.Neelam, Prof. Rajinder Kumar. She also stressed on the need of conducting awareness programs on Career opportunities on regular intervals.

The Programme concluded with the formal Vote of thanks by Prof.Suman Bala, member Institutional innovation Club.
